Job Opportunity: Lead Carpenter

Location: London, ON and surrounding areas

Type: Full-time, permanent role (Monday-Friday, 8-5)

Benefits: Competitive wages, health benefits, uniforms, growth opportunities

Certification: Red Seal certification is a plus

About CCR Building and Remodeling

We’re an award-winning, London-based renovation company with over 30 years of experience in creative carpentry, design, and build initiatives. We pride ourselves on transforming customer dreams into reality while maintaining a positive, family-oriented team environment.

Responsibilities
  1. Complete carpentry work on job sites from start to finish, including trim, framing, and drywall.
  2. Review job plans, documents, and checklists pre-construction; coordinate materials and resources.
  3. Build according to drawings and project specifications.
  4. Lead and delegate tasks to on-site laborers for timely project completion.
  5. Ensure high-quality workmanship and uphold safety standards.
  6. Maintain site cleanliness.
Qualifications
  1. 5+ years of carpentry experience, especially in remodeling trades.
  2. Experience supervising or managing renovation projects.
  3. Ability to read blueprints, drawings, and layouts.
  4. Valid driver’s license and good driving record.
  5. Basic carpentry tools (hand tools, skill saw, levels, squares, drills, hammer drill, nailers, ladders).
  6. Certifications such as fall arrest, WHMIS, first aid are assets.
  7. Red Seal Carpentry certification is a plus but not required.
